Dion Lee - Liquidation

The Australian arm of global fashion brand Dion Lee entered liquidation on 29 August after a three-month search for a buyer failed to result in a deal.
The company — whose clothing has been worn by the likes of Taylor Swift and Dua Lipa — entered voluntary administration on 22 May owing approximately $35 million to creditors.
Despite initial reports that a sale was likely, no acceptable offer was forthcoming. As a result, creditors voted to put the company into liquidation.
Antony Resnick and Henry Kwok of dVT Group, already Dion Lee’s administrators, were appointed liquidators.
Remaining stores are expected to close in late September or early October.
